1099-A Tax Form Advise, Please....I am from WI and in Sept. 2009 our Chapter 7 Bankruptcy was Discharged which included our home. Now we received a 1099-A and desperately need answers as to how, if anything, we need to do with this form and our 2010 Income Taxes. Our bankruptcy attorney told us we did not have to do anything with that on our taxes; however, an accountant told me that we have to file a 982 form (I think it was); does anyone know exactly we need to do with that form on our taxes? Please Help!
